Two Dallas high-school students discovered 5 stars as members of a Southern Methodist University (SMU) summer physics research program, QuarkNet, that enabled them to analyze data gleaned from a high-powered telescope in Los Alamos, N.M. The University of Texas at Austin, Department of Computer Science, offers three summer camp programs for high school students: First Bytes and Code Longhorn are free, one-week residential camp programs designed to dispel myths about computer science and intrigue students with the potential of computing and the excitement of problem solving.
